What is the price of a BMW X1 in Nepal?

As of mid-2026, BMW X1 ICE variants in Nepal cost around Rs 1.9 crore to Rs 2.3 crore depending on engine, trim and duties.

Is the BMW X1 a good car to buy in Nepal?

Yes, if you value prestige, quality, and modern features, especially for urban use—but high costs of purchase, maintenance, and rough roads can diminish its value. Seen as good by those wanting luxury feel more than rugged toughness.

Is the BMW X1 a 7-seater?

No, the BMW X1 is a compact SUV with 5 seats and there's no 7-seater version, in Nepal or anywhere else. Buyers here wanting more seats usually look at the X3 or bigger SUVs instead.

Price, service, resale and roads — here

  • BMW X1 (ICE) price in Nepal ~Rs 1.9–2.3 crore depending on variant
  • Service centres mainly in Kathmandu/Pokhara; parts/servicing expensive and long waits elsewhere
  • Ground clearance and ride durability concerns for rural/rough roads
